Explain how to thread FCAW wire.

Cut off the end of the electrode wire if it is bent. When working with the wire, be sure to hold it tightly. The wire will become tangled if it is released. The wire has a natural curl known as cast. Straighten out about 12 in. (300 mm) of the curl to make threading easier.
Separate the wire feed rollers and push the wire first through the guides, then between the rollers, and finally into the conduit liner. Reset the rollers so there is a slight amount of compression on the wire. Set the wire-feed speed control to a slow speed. Hold the welding gun so that the electrode conduit and cable are as straight as possible.
Press the gun switch. Pressing the gun switch to start the wire feeder is called triggering the gun. The wire should start feeding into the liner. Watch to make certain that the wire feeds smoothly and release the gun switch as soon as the end comes through the gun.
If the wire stops feeding before it reaches the end of the gun, stop and check the system. If no obvious problem can be found, mark the wire with tape and remove it from the gun. It then can be held next to the system to determine the location of the problem.
With the wire feed running, adjust the feed roller compression so that the wire reel can be stopped easily by a slight pressure. Too light a roller pressure will cause the wire to feed erratically. Too high a pressure can crush some wires, causing some flux to be dropped inside the wire liner. If this happens, you will have a continual problem with the wire not feeding smoothly or jamming.
With the feed running, adjust the spool drag so that the reel stops when the feed stops. The reel should not coast to a stop, because the wire can be snagged easily. Also, when the feed restarts, a jolt occurs when the slack in the wire is taken up. This jolt can be enough to momentarily stop the wire, possibly causing a discontinuity in the weld.
